Output ddd27feff3106a30d744e08eb38b270c8f2f4e2aeacb26131b1b76eef86cafc0:4

value
2313134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3e5efa2ddfcba3616e2c702e8db85293af1c84 OP_EQUAL
address
3HJUBxeCkNrLggPjNuKRwe97MMRPYdxbbx
transaction
ddd27feff3106a30d744e08eb38b270c8f2f4e2aeacb26131b1b76eef86cafc0
spent
true